Phil Douglis17-Feb-2008 22:33
This guy looks familiar. Compare the differences by going tohttp://www.pbase.com/image/45582846
You choose to use black and white, while I kept the faint color of the marble. I add tension by allowing the subject float in darkness, while you bring the lower edge into the sculpture. My image is darker, which I did in post-processing, which conceals the wire that comes out of his head and makes him seem to float even more. I wanted to send the viewer back into time here. Both images are incongruous because the dead bishop seems to be just resting,
with his hands on head and book.
